当前位置: 首页 > wzjs >正文

自己建网站做网店为什么网站打开是空白

自己建网站做网店,为什么网站打开是空白,做企业网站需要买什么,php mysql怎么编写视频网站引子:当新手遇到 "天书" 般的报错 作为刚加入团队的开发者,我在接手一个遗留的 Python 数据处理项目时,遇到了一个诡异报错: python 复制 下载 ValueError: shape mismatch: value array of shape (500,) could no…

引子:当新手遇到 "天书" 般的报错

作为刚加入团队的开发者,我在接手一个遗留的 Python 数据处理项目时,遇到了一个诡异报错:

python

复制

下载

ValueError: shape mismatch: value array of shape (500,) could not be broadcast to indexing result of shape (300,)

更崩溃的是:

  • 项目没有完善的文档(只有零散的 Slack 讨论记录)

  • 原开发者已离职,无人可问

  • 该 Bug 在特定数据条件下才会触发,手动调试耗时极长

传统解决方式

  1. 在 Stack Overflow 盲目搜索相似问题(耗时 30+ 分钟)

  2. 逐行打断点调试(可能引入新 Bug)

  3. 最终可能仍无法理解根本原因

Trae 的解决方式

python

复制

下载

@数据分析师 #Doc ./slack_logs/ #Web https://numpy.org/doc/  
请分析这个 ValueError 的成因:  
- 为什么 shape (500,) 无法广播到 (300,)?  
- 如何修改代码使其兼容不同尺寸的输入?  
(附上完整报错堆栈和代码片段)

一、@智能体 + #上下文 的黄金组合

1.1 第一步:用 #Doc 加载团队知识

  • 上传 Slack 历史讨论记录(.md 格式)

  • Trae 自动提取关键信息:

    "该模块需要处理不同分片的数据,但老代码假设所有分片大小相同" —— 2023-12-05 的讨论

(插入 Trae 界面截图:展示从聊天记录中高亮提取关键信息)

1.2 第二步:用 #Web 获取权威解释

  • 自动抓取 NumPy 广播机制官方文档

  • 生成通俗易懂的示意图:

    复制

    下载

    输入A (500,) → 无法自动对齐 → 目标B (300,)  
    解决方案:  
    1. 使用 np.resize() 统一尺寸  
    2. 添加尺寸检查逻辑

1.3 第三步:@智能体 给出可落地方案

Trae 不仅解释问题,还直接生成修复代码:

python

复制

下载

# 修改前(问题代码)
result = raw_data[indices] * coefficients  # 修改后(智能建议)
if len(coefficients) != len(indices):coefficients = np.resize(coefficients, len(indices))  # 自动对齐尺寸
result = raw_data[indices] * coefficients

二、为什么这代表未来?

2.1 与传统调试工具对比

方式耗时需要技能准确率
手动调试2h+精通 NumPy
普通 ChatGPT30min会提问中等
Trae @智能体5min会描述问题

2.2 关键突破

  1. 对话即终端

    • 无需学习复杂 IDE 调试功能

    • 像请教人类专家一样自然提问

  2. 上下文主动融合

    • 自动关联 Slack 历史、文档、网络资源

    • 传统工具需要手动复制粘贴这些信息

  3. 可复用的解决方案

    markdown

    复制

    下载

    @智能体 将刚才的修复方案保存为项目规则:  
    "所有数组操作前必须进行尺寸校验"  

    (自动写入 .trae/rules/project_rules.md

三、延伸场景:让 Bug 修复自动化

案例:自动拦截同类错误

通过配置 MCP 监控:

python

复制

下载

@智能体 with MCP  
1. 在 CI 流水线中添加规则:  - 检测到 "shape mismatch" 时自动中断构建  
2. 自动提交 PR 添加尺寸校验逻辑  

(插入 CI 流水线自动修复的动图演示)


结语:这不是优化,而是范式革命

当你的开发环境能:

  1. 听懂自然语言描述的问题

  2. 记住所有历史讨论和文档

  3. 主动给出符合规范的代码

编程将不再是 "孤独的调试",而是 与 AI 的持续对话

http://www.dtcms.com/wzjs/812699.html

相关文章:

  • 做彩铃网站好的域名推荐
  • 网站的优化用什么软件下载建e室内设计网专业的室内设计
  • 六安市百姓畅言六安杂谈开鲁网站seo不用下载
  • 鹰潭市网站建设可以做免费广告的网站有哪些
  • 连锁酒店设计网站建设网址注册查询
  • 物流公司做网站需求做图标去什么网站找
  • 网站服务器和vps做一台织梦网站怎么做301跳转
  • wordpress0商业网站如何制作一个单页网站
  • 百度网站怎么做友情链接上海工商营业执照查询官网
  • 新型城镇化建设网站国内开源网站
  • 福州企业建站系统全球购物网站大全
  • 上海工程建设安全协会网站世界卫生健康论坛
  • 刷网站关键词排名原理网站和二级目录权重
  • 亳州市网站建设科技之全球垄断
  • 建设工程图审管理信息系统网站设计素材网站哪个好用
  • 小蘑菇网站建设下载免费信息发布平台
  • 烟台网站建设服务网站建设与规划前景
  • 销售一个产品的网站怎么做的个人房源网
  • 河南电商网站设计管理员网站后台上传本地视频
  • 建设银行注册网站首页森马网站建设情况
  • 嘉兴南湖区建设局网站手机百度app
  • 安吉网站制作汽车品牌推广方案
  • 网站开发要会英语吗做网站主要注意些什么
  • 西安中交建设集团网站wordpress图床
  • 单位不能建设网站丹灶网站建设公司
  • 微信网站开发制作平台wordpress 微博主题 twitter主题
  • 正一品网站建设全网营销推广运营培训学校
  • 网站上传发生一个ftp错误什么是网络营销?
  • 怎么用百度云做网站空间女性时尚网站模板
  • 网站建设保障措施简易购物网站模板